Condition

This work is in good condition overall. The sheet is hinged verso to the backing board in multiple locations. There is light wear along the extreme edges of the sheet. Under raking there is evidence of scattered faint creases to the sheet, most noticeably in the upper right quadrant above the door frame, in the center left edge of the image, just left of the figure’s skirt and in the lower right edge of the white margin. There is a soft undulation throughout the sheet and some minor lifting along the edges and at the corners. Framed under Plexiglas.
